Output d71ae8e5630eed0d595eb5990c64fc896c54086034b0c29165dc5e7aec4bdc7f:39

value
62417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b833421cdae9e5c71e5a71bf9e94c9821b447db OP_EQUAL
address
3FsHqTziTbG5qHTAYD7yjEpLphz1ukGGC4
transaction
d71ae8e5630eed0d595eb5990c64fc896c54086034b0c29165dc5e7aec4bdc7f
confirmations
3222
spent
true